When it comes to organizing a successful sports event, many elements come into play—from logistics and scheduling to participant safety and audience engagement. One often-overlooked aspect that plays a crucial role in ensuring the smooth operation of any sporting event is the use of fencing. Temporary fencing solutions provide essential support for managing crowds, protecting athletes, and maintaining the overall integrity of the event.
This blog delves into the multifaceted role of fencing in sports event organization, exploring how it contributes to safety, security, and efficiency. Renting a Fence serves as a physical barrier that defines boundaries, keeping spectators at a safe distance from the action and ensuring that athletes can perform without distractions. By clearly marking event perimeters, fencing helps to guide foot traffic, preventing congestion and minimizing the risk of accidents.
Moreover, fencing is instrumental in crowd control. In high-energy environments like sports events, the enthusiasm of fans can quickly escalate. Temporary fencing creates designated areas for spectators, ensuring they remain organized and safe while providing event staff with the tools needed to manage the audience effectively. This not only enhances the experience for attendees but also allows for quick and efficient evacuation if necessary.
Additionally, fencing serves as a valuable tool for branding and sponsorship opportunities. Event organizers can use the fencing itself as a canvas for promotional materials, creating a visually appealing environment that showcases sponsors while reinforcing the event's identity. This can enhance the overall atmosphere and provide a unique marketing platform for sponsors.
In terms of logistics, renting fencing is a cost-effective and flexible solution for sports event organizers. With various options available, from chain-link to privacy fencing, organizers can select the type that best suits their needs. The ease of installation and removal means that event planners can focus on other critical aspects of their event without worrying about permanent installations.
